Dango Mitsuki is a chunin of Konohagakure known for his keen powers of observation. In his free time he likes nothing better than gazing up at the moon, a habit that has left a permanent mark on the way he looks at the world.
Dango is a young man whose dark hair sits above a pair of small, dark eyes that he tends to keep narrowed, a squint born of all the hours he spends moon-watching. He turns out in the usual Konoha getup, a bandanna-style forehead protector and flak jacket among it.
Little is on record about Dango beyond his talent for noticing things others miss. Away from duty, he passes his time looking at the moon.
During the run-up to the Fourth Shinobi World War, Dango served with the version of the Infiltration and Reconnaissance Party that trailed Kabuto Yakushi to the Mountains' Graveyard, where the discovery that Kabuto had allied himself with Tobi left him stunned.
